Nestled on the upper reaches of the prestigious Lincombes Hillside, this coastal apartment boasts panoramic views of the sea and the surrounding tree-lined area, offering a picturesque setting that epitomises the beauty of the English Riviera. Available for the first time since 1972, the property presents a wonderful opportunity for those seeking to enhance a home to their own style, priced to reflect modernisation. Enviably placed on the entrance level, you are immediately drawn to the dramatic views from the large picture windows and extensive private sun terrace which presents a perfect space for relaxation and outdoor entertainment. The property affords a larger three bedroom design, with a garage providing secure parking and useful storage.

Situated in close proximity to the picturesque Ilsham Valley and Meadfoot Beach where leisurely walks can be enjoyed along the coastline. For those seeking a vibrant social scene, Torquay's bustling harbour and marina are located at the base of the hill to the west, offering a multitude of dining, shopping, mooring, and entertainment options.

Owners Insight

"Our late Uncle purchased 18 Rozel in 1972 and we believe that he was the second owner of the flat. Property was a great interest of his and No.18, with its excellent position and having the extra bedroom, that he used as a dining room, was a much loved second home for 53 years. As children we enjoyed many holidays with our parents and we were also fortunate to be able to use the flat with our own families as well.

Coming back to the property, as we prepared it for sale, has brought back many happy memories of our much loved Uncle and the sunshine filled holidays spent at Rozel. The flat is pretty much as it was in 1972, although the bathroom was replaced some years ago and, what was the original cloakroom, is now a useful en-suite. We will never forget the amazing sea view from the picture window.

Clearly it could now do with some up-dating but any money invested here will be well spent if it gives the new owner anything like the happiness our Uncle had here."

Step Inside

A covered gentle stepped approach leads to the secure communal entrance, with the apartment situated on the entrance level. A private front door opens to the entrance vestibule with storage cupboards and privacy screening from the sitting/dining room. A striking room featuring a picture window encapsulating the exceptional views over the surrounding area to the sea at Tor Bay. Two sets of French doors link the principal room and the private sun terrace. Inner hall with airing cupboard housing the lagged cylinder and further storage. The kitchen, we believe to be original from when constructed circa 1962, features picture windows taking full advantage of the outstanding views beyond the private terrace to the sea.

Bedrooms & Bathrooms

Bedroom 1 is currently utilised as a dining room with fitted storage, facing the beautiful southerly aspect with direct access to the private terrace. Bedrooms 2 and 3 are both double bedrooms, having fitted wardrobes and outlooks toward the front approach. Bedroom 3 benefits from an en-suite shower room with natural light. Family bathroom with white suite, fully tiled walls and floor and obscure glazed window.

Step Outside

The private paved terrace is a particular attribute, facing southerly with panoramic views of Tor Bay and the surrounding tree lined area. To the southerly elevation is also a communal garden for the residents enjoyment, arranged in tiers and mainly laid to lawn with mature hedging and shrubs. To the approach off Middle Lincombe Road is a private garage (no 7) situated in the block directly opposite the apartment.

Additional Informaiton

Access: Slight stepped approach from the garage to the communal entrance.
Heating: Electric.
Length of lease: 999 years (less 3 days) from 25 December 1962.
Service charge: £3617.98
council tax band: E (Torbay Council). Full charge payable for 2025/2026 is £2,859.80.
Conservation area: Lincombes, Torquay.
Broadband & mobile: We are advised that Standard & Superfast Broadband is available in the area via Openreach, with mobile signal limited (according to the Ofcom website).

Our Area

Torquay is nestled on the warm South Devon coast being one of three towns along with Paignton and Brixham which form the natural east facing harbour of Torbay, sheltered from the English Channel. Torbay's wide selection of stunning beaches, picturesque coastline, mild climate and recreational facilities reinforce why it has rightfully earned the renowned nickname of the English Riviera.

Torquay Is Well Connected

By Train: Torquay Train Station has some direct lines to London Paddington and Birmingham and is just one stop from the main line Newton Abbot. By Air: Exeter Airport provides both UK and international flights. By Sea: Torquay Marina provides a safe haven for boats in all weathers, sheltered from the prevailing south-westerly winds. Regional Cities of Exeter & Plymouth approximately 22 miles and 32 miles respectively. Magnificent Dartmoor National park approximately 12 miles.
